Hi all,
This series includes a set of fixes for LLVM/Clang when building
pseries_defconfig. These have been floating around as standalone
patches so I decided to gather them up as a series so it was easier
to review/apply them.
This has been broken for a bit now, it would be nice to get these
reviewed and applied. Please let me know if I need to do anything
to move these along.
